Distress Oxide Background Card

Today I played some more with my distress oxide inks. 
To create the panel, I used bristol smooth paper and Tim Holtz distress oxide inks.  I rubbed the inks onto my craft mat, spritzed water to them, and smooshed my card into the inks.  I repeated, heating between each addition of color, and added some water droplets to get the oxidation process going.  I used a scrap piece that I had left over from cutting larger pieces.

I black embossed a stamp from Simon Says Stamp Handwritten Floral Greetings set and a verse from their Blessed set.  I added the panel to an A2 lavender card, and added black lines above and below the panel with a black micron pen.  Some Studio Katia sparkling crystals finish off my card.

Travels by Sea

I was very happy to see Simon Says Stamp Monday Challenge is 'By The Sea," as it challenged me to do something with the Tim Holtz sea shell stamps....well, at least one of them.  I chose the star fish, and my Polychromos colored pencils.  I colored the image, shaded, and added some other stamps from my stash (script, compass, patterns), to carry the distress/collage/sea theme throughout.  
 I layered it onto some blue mulberry paper, tied some twine, and added some accents from my treasures....charms, trinkets, paper clips, and a little piece of a fiber sheet.  See, I used some for yesterday's post, then had it in my mind for today.  Love using my stash!  I added some highlights with my white Signo pen.
